Justin has been working on target mode for the Adaptec (ahc) driver.  His
test systems have 7890's and 7895's on board.  I don't think he has quite
gotten the target + initiator sequencer code to fit on a 7880.

It does work well enough that he can talk between two systems via the
initiator and target pt drivers.

If you're going to play around with target mode under CAM, you should
either get an Adaptec 7890/7891/7896/7897 based board, an Adaptec 7895
based board, or a QLogic board.  The Ultra 2 Adaptec chips are preferrable
to the 7895, since they're faster and have more instruction space.  If you
get a QLogic board, you'll want to talk to Matt Jacob first about what
model to get...
